From page 1
The first data page shows the open door: field networks rank highest on reconciliation and onboarding pain, while only a small share have invested in a purpose-built 1099 system.
76%
flag payment-reconciliation delays as the top contractor complaint.
#1 of seven verticals.
74%
flag background checks as a top onboarding challenge.
Next-closest vertical is seven points behind.
15%
have invested in a purpose-built 1099 management system.
The lowest rate of any vertical.
The takeaway
The reconciliation cliff at $1M in monthly contractor spend is where field-network buyers finally start shopping.
